So I was invited along to Feel Electric EMS Fitness in Harrogate to try out their 20 minute work out sessions & I wasn’t quite sure what to expect……EMS means Electro Muscle Stimulation…….I was a little nervous! However on arriving my mind was put at rest – the staff were brill & Sam took me though everything & explained how it all worked.
I thought I would be hooked up to some machines & just kind of wait, but it was a little different than expected. I was handed a top & shorts to wear so went to get changed. The changing rooms are really light & airy & clean. I donned my suit (think wetsuit) and vest (where they hook the wires up to) along with my socks and we started the workout.
Sam explained how the machine worked – the electrical impulses reach deep layers of your muscles & this leaves you toned, stronger & energised. To begin the impulses are low & they find the right setting for you. I can only describe it as tickly……not unpleasant at all, just a strange sensation. The sessions are all 1-2-1 & last around 20 minutes. We worked our way through a range of different movements for the whole body & I definitely felt it, and I felt like I had completed a work out. The time passed by really quickly & I really enjoyed it – it was a fun way to workout & only 20 minutes to achieve a full body work out – win win!!!!
Afterwards I got changed – everyone receives a brand new suit so it’s really safe – if you sign up for a course you keep the suit so have your own.
I think it’s a really great workout – I wasn’t sure I would ‘feel’ like I’d worked out, but I really did. The optimum time to do this is once a week, so can be the only thing you do, or in conjunction with other activities. If you are time poor then check it out, as you can achieve so much in a short space of time! it’s suitable for all ages & abilities as the exercises are tailored to you. The fact that it’s 1-2-1 make it really safe and focused on your goals as well.
